Medical Laser Systems Market size was valued at USD 5.35 Billion in 2024 and is poised to grow from USD 5.97 Billion in 2025 to USD 14.26 Billion by 2033, growing at a CAGR of 11.5% during the forecast period (2026-2033).
The medical laser systems market is poised for significant growth driven by an increasing demand for non-invasive procedures and a rise in chronic illnesses. The versatility of medical lasers, which are essential for both diagnostic and therapeutic applications, fuels their widespread adoption across specialties such as dentistry, ophthalmology, and dermatology. Their effectiveness in procedures like laser eye surgery, skin resurfacing, and targeted tumor removal enhances their market appeal. Additionally, advancements in laser technology and a growing inclination toward innovative laser-based treatments contribute to this expansion. Notably, dermatological and cosmetic clinics are projected to experience rapid growth, highlighting a strong consumer interest in aesthetic applications of laser treatments and the demand for enhanced skincare solutions.

Medical Laser Systems Market Segments Analysis
Global Medical Laser Systems Market is segmented by product, application, end use and region. Based on product, the market is segmented into diode lasers, solid state lasers, gas lasers and dye lasers. Based on application, the market is segmented into dermatology, ophthalmology, gynecology, urology, dentistry, cardiovascular and others. Based on end use, the market is segmented into hospital, dermatology and cosmetics clinic, opthalmic clinics and others.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Medical Laser Systems Market
The Medical Laser Systems market is significantly driven by technological advancements in flap production, particularly with the development of femtosecond lasers, which have enhanced vision clarity and minimized complications such as flap issues and postoperative dry eye disease (DED). Additionally, improved laser ablation profiles have contributed to superior vision quality, especially in low-light environments. As the prevalence of eye diseases continues to rise globally, the need for effective medical lasers has become increasingly pressing, highlighting the essential role these advanced technologies play in enhancing patient outcomes and addressing widespread vision health concerns.
Restraints in the Medical Laser Systems Market
The expansion of the medical laser systems market faces obstacles due to rigorous safety regulations and elevated rates of equipment malfunction. Additionally, developing countries grapple with insufficient healthcare infrastructure and a scarcity of skilled professionals, which further complicates the adoption of these technologies. As a result, the overall confidence of the general population in pursuing treatment options using medical lasers may diminish, ultimately impacting demand and stifling market growth. The interplay of these factors creates a challenging environment for stakeholders looking to capitalize on advancements in medical laser technology, highlighting the necessity for solutions that address these shortcomings.
Market Trends of the Medical Laser Systems Market
The Medical Laser Systems market is experiencing significant growth driven by advancements in laser vision correction and innovative dermatological technologies. The increasing acceptance of procedures such as PRK, SMILE, and LASIK reflects a broader consumer shift towards non-invasive treatments for vision correction. Concurrently, dermatology is evolving as traditional therapies cede ground to state-of-the-art laser solutions, enhancing skin rejuvenation and treatment efficacy. This trend indicates a robust demand for advanced laser systems that cater to both aesthetic and therapeutic applications. As healthcare providers adopt these technologies, the market is poised for substantial expansion, propelled by rising consumer awareness and technological innovation.
